Why drains in Alexandria behave the method they do

Plumbing issues follow the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ial actors i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to oil and lint. Those pipelines were meant for a different period of soaps and water use. With time, internal scaling tightens the size, and every bit of hardened fat or coffee ground has more locations to capture. Farther west toward Academy Road and Beauregard, post-war homes often have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have actually lived past their convenience zone. Clay areas change at joints and welcome hairline origin intrusion. The roots thrive where grass irrigation and structure growings keep the soil dam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ees large swings in between soaking storms and dry spells. After heavy rain, sump pumps press even more water toward major lines, and any type of weak point in a sewage system ends up being visible. Throughout cold snaps, oil in kitchen area runs comes to be a waxy cork. The city's slim streets and shared easements make complex access. A specialist drain cleaning service that functions below regularly finds out to stage devices with marginal impact,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out accessibility, and prepare for the old-house quirks that do not show up in a textbook.

What a proficient drain cleaning check out actually looks like

A typical solution phone call must begin with a conversation and a fast study.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of background assists.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has actually been sluggish for a year and the kitchen area supported recently, those truths indicate separate issues. One is likely a regional obstruction in the catch arm or vertical stack. The other might be a grease choke in the horizontal kitchen area run or a partial obstruction generally. A tech who pays attention can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job divides into accessibility, medical diagnosis, and removal. Gain access to depends upon the component and where the blockage is, yet cleanouts are the most effective starting factor. If a residential property does not have functional cleanouts, it may call for drawing a bathroom or eliminating a catch. For medical diagnosis, experts rely upon two devices as a baseline: a cord device and a video camera. The cable television determines whether the line is openable. The electronic camera reveals why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able work has its own skill. On a kitchen line, cable television choice matters due to the fact that soft cable televisions pierce with oil and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scuffing a tidy path. A stiffer wire with a correctly sized blade often tends to cut rather than poke openings, which implies the line stays clear longer. In actors iron, oscillating and step-by-step onward stress prevents gouging a currently thin wall surface. In clay laterals with roots, you do not wish to ram the cable television so hard that it expands a joint. The objective is regulated reducing, not brute force.

Once flow is recovered, the camera tells the truth. I have actually discovered offsets that only block when a washing machine discharges at complete rate, and bellies that hold just sufficient water to catch paper for weeks. Without a video camera, you might think the obstruction is random and brace for the following one. With video clip, you understand whether you require a repair, a hydro jetting service, or just much better habits.

Clogged drain fixing, crafted for the precise problem

Clogged drains are not a single classification. Hair in a bathtub waste calls for a different tou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air clogs reply to manual removal and a brief wire run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ever setting up with a corroded spring, that system might be the real trouble, capturing hair like a rake. Changing the setting up while the line is open prevents the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ern meal soaps cut oil much better than they used to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ipeline w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me products have their area for maintenance, but they can not excavate hardened fats that have cooled and layered. On an oil line, a two-step strategy functions best: mechanical cutting to restore flow, then a controlled hot water flush to rinse put on hold fats downstream. If the grease extends right into the main, or if the buildup is hefty and layered,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ter choice than repeated cabling.

Toilets present their own problems. A solitary obstruction after an inexpedient flush of wipes is something. Repeated blockages indicate a trap style iss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age beyond the closet bend. I have actually found toy d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the property owner, that only triggered troubles when paper stuck behind them. An electronic camera with a small head can slide past the commode flange after pulling the fixture, and that five-minute appearance can conserve you replacing a whole bathroom that is blameless.

Basement floor drains pipes and washing standpipes frequently misinform. When both back-up, lots of people presume the main sewer is blocked. A major drain cleaning service examinations fixtures one at a time, enjoys flows, and associates the timing of backups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ures however burps throughout a washing machine cycle, capability, not outright blockage,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the best move

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water, normally between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, delivered via a hose with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and combs the pipe wall, and the back jets draw the pipe forward while flushing particles back to the cleanout. For heavy grease and split scale, it is extra reliable than cabling because it cleans the full circ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line more evenly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to catch paper.

Jetting brings its very own policies. Pipe condition dictates stress and nozzle selection. In breakable cast iron with apparent thinning, make use of reduced pressure and a rotating nozzle that brightens rather than chisels. In more recent PVC, greater pressure with a warthog or similar nozzle removes sludge quickly without danger. An experienced tech determines exactly how promptly the line is removing by the feel of the tube, the sound of return water, and the debris leaving the cleanout. If sand or accumulation puts out, you might be taking care of a broken pipeline or a collapsed area, and every min of jetting need to be stabilized versus the risk of cleaning much more bed linen away.

The ideal usage situ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drainpipe with scale and paper problems, and commercial lines that see consistent food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Opportunity recognize the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ains solution uninterrupted. For a property owner with recurring kitchen area sink back-ups every 3 months, a single jetting commonly resets the clock for a year or more, offered the line is audio and the house stays clear of unloading o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that respects the line and the property

Sewer cleansing is about bring back circulation, but that does not indicate sacrificing the backyard or the walkway. Alexandria's slim whole lots typically conceal the sewage system lateral beneath yard beds and stone pathways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service stages hose pipes and equipments to protect growings and prevents unnecessary excavation. Begin with every accessible cleanout. If the property lacks one near the front, it might be worth setting up a new cleanout at the residential or commercial property line. That single renovation can turn a half-day battle right into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a drain ought to be a gauged process. If roots are present, a collection of progressively larger blades is far better than leaping to the optimum size and chewing the joint into an unequal birthed. Video camera evaluation after the initial pass informs you where the roots are getting in. Several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from your house to the pathway, after that a PVC replacement to the city main. The shift is where origins attack. When you know the specific place, you can reduce easily and discuss whether an area repair service, liner, or proceeded maintenance makes sense.

Grease in a drain is less typical for single-family homes, however multi-unit structures and buildings with cellar cooking areas see it extra. Jetting excels below, with a final pass of warm water to bring the slurry downstream. If numerous devices add to the line, the routine matters as long as the method. Collaborating a building-wide cooking area pause throughout the service avoids fresh discharge from relocating grease right into a newly cleansed segment.

The math behind "rooter now, fixing later on"

Not every issue warrants instant replacement. I lug a collection of examples in my head from jobs where patience and upkeep functioned far better than a rush to dig. A home ow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a single joint, 6 feet from the aesthetic.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a slight countered on camera without much soil noticeable. As opposed to trench a rock sidewalk and interfere with the well established boxwoods, we set up orig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dose of root control foam after the springtime growth flush. That was 8 years ago. The sidewalk is undamaged, and overall upkeep costs still rest listed below the price of excavation by a wide margin.

On the various other hand, I have seen stomaches that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Cam footage reveals paper being in the dip, moving just with heavy circulations. In those cases, no amount of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can preserve around a belly, however you will certainly live with periodic downturns and stricter regulations concerning what decreases. If the belly s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air with the paving. You only want to excavate once.

Practical practices that lower obstructions without babying the system

Some behaviors carry even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the bad guys they are made out to be, yet they can be abused. Coffee premises are great in small amounts if flushed with great deals of water, however they become mortar when blended with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" disperse slowly and tangle in rough pipe walls. Soap residue in older bathtubs is more about water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Washing hair catchers and routine enzyme upkeep aid ma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after oily cooking nights makes a distinction. Run the faucet on warm for a min after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old oil, but it pushes soft residues out of the trap arm and right into bigger diameter pipe where they are less lik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ons prevents a rise that overwhelms limited standpipes. If your video camera showed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air: just how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air service as the repair. Cabling is precise for difficult blockages, origins, and localized cl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, oil, sludge, and scale. Repair or lining solves geometry troubles, busted segments, and significant intrusions.

If your main has a single root invasion at a joint and the pipeline is or else solid, cabling followed by root-specific jetting provides you clean walls and a much longer interval in between brows through. If your kitchen area line is slow every month and the camera reveals heavy grease from end to end, jetting is worth the financial investment. If the camera shows a collapse, a deep stubborn belly, or a significant offset, skip duplicated cleansing and rate the repair. In Alexandria, lots of laterals are shallow near your house and deeper near the visual. Finding the defect might reveal a fixing only 3 feet deep next to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Roadway, 3 neighbors called within 2 months with the very same complaint: slow first-floor bathrooms, gurgling tub drains, and occasional cellar flooring drain dampness after tornados. The common factor was a clay segment just before the city main, gotten into by origins. Each home had a various layout, however the video camera informed the very same story. The first property owner went with biannual origin cutting. The 2nd chose hydro jetting plus a foam root therapy. The third arranged an area fixing before a planned patio renovation. A year later on, all three continued to be pleased, each with an option matched to their budget and resistance for recurring ma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a household had problem with a kitchen area line that obstructed every six weeks. The run traveled via an ended up ceiling and turned two times previously going down to the main. Cord passes opened up flow, however oil returned swiftly. We jetted the line with a small spinning nozzle at modest stress, after that purged with hot water and degreaser. The video camera showed a clean, intense interior. We moved the air admittance shutoff to improve venting, which reduced the sink's sluggishness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following solution phone call, and that one was for a lavatory s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a solitary component is sluggish, clear the catch and inspect the vent. In some cases a bird nest or a leaf mat on a level roof vent produces unfavorable stress that mimics a clog. For a persistent kitchen sink that is still draining slowly, a long, stable warm water run can press soft grease past a sticky section. Stay clear of putting chemicals right into the drainpipe. They can burn a technology throughout service, and they rarely touch the actual obstruction. If several fixtures at the lowest level are supporting, stop making use of water and ask for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water dangers flooding and damages, and any kind of additional disc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.
